Technical Matters.

Free Fatty Acids:

The quality of any oil is determined by the free fatty acid levels as they indicate the grade of molecular disintegration (age) of an oil.


Peroxide Levels.

This is a widely debated issue.


The Therapeutic Goods Administration in Australia (TGA) has ruled that Emu oil when used as a complementary medicine in Australia, must have peroxide levels below 10. This issue is disputed by the federal body of the Australian Emu Industry which has applied to TGA to raise the peroxide levels from 10 to 20.

Our rendering plant certification has been for Emu oil as a food supplement which is for peroxide levels up to 18 for this purpose. It has been issued before TGA categorised Emu oil as a complementary medicine.

In Asia and Europe Emu oil is a food supplement or a cosmetic ingredient, as it comes from a farmed animal and is 100% natural.

Our experience - and many scientific tests -  with Emu oil have shown that peroxide levels of the highest biologically active Emu oils are very rarely below 20.

Corn oil as a comparison has peroxide levels of more than 60 and this is considered o.k.

 

 

EMU OIL TYPICAL SPECIFICATIONS

  1. The oil has been solely derived from Emu fat and has not been blended with any other oil
  2. No added preservatives or anti oxidants.
  3. Inert gas (food grade argon) is added, at the time of sealing containers.
  4. Emu oil is considered a non-hazardous material as far as shipping is concerned.  Flash point <140 ºC
  5. All of the following Specifications are typical working standards for typical commercial Emu oil.
